Hướng dẫn what is percentage in python - phần trăm trong python là bao nhiêu

Hướng dẫn what is percentage in python - phần trăm trong python là bao nhiêu

Cập nhật lần cuối vào ngày 23 tháng 9 năm 2022 lúc 10:57 tối

Không có nhà điều hành phần trăm trong Python để tính toán tỷ lệ phần trăm, nhưng không liên quan để tự thực hiện.

Để tính toán tỷ lệ phần trăm trong Python, hãy sử dụng toán tử phân chia (/) để lấy chỉ số từ hai số và sau đó nhân số này với 100 bằng cách sử dụng toán tử nhân (*) để có được tỷ lệ phần trăm.calculate a percentage in Python, use the division operator (/) to get the quotient from two numbers and then multiply this quotient by 100 using the multiplication operator (*) to get the percentage.

quotient = 3 / 5

percent = quotient * 100

print(percent)

Đầu ra

60.0

Điều đó có nghĩa là 60%.

Bạn có thể tạo một chức năng tùy chỉnh trong Python để tính tỷ lệ phần trăm.

def percentage(part, whole):
  percentage = 100 * float(part)/float(whole)
  return str(percentage) + "%"

print(percentage(3, 5))

Đầu ra

60.0%

Điều đó có nghĩa là 60%.

Bạn có thể tạo một chức năng tùy chỉnh trong Python để tính tỷ lệ phần trăm.

def percent(x, y):
    if not x and not y:
        print("x = 0%\ny = 0%")
    elif x < 0 or y < 0:
        print("The inputs can't be negative!")
    else:
        final = 100 / (x + y)
        x *= final
        y *= final
        print('x = {}%\ny = {}%'.format(x, y))

percent(3, 6)

Đầu ra

x = 33.33333333333333%
y = 66.66666666666666%

Điều đó có nghĩa là 60%.

Bạn có thể tạo một chức năng tùy chỉnh trong Python để tính tỷ lệ phần trăm.percent sign in Python is called modulo operator “%,” which returns the remainder after dividing the left-hand operand by the right-hand operand.

data = 3
info = 2
remainder = data % info
print(remainder)

Đầu ra

1

Điều đó có nghĩa là 60%.1“. Here, the modulo operator “%” returns the remainder after dividing the two numbers.

Bạn có thể tạo một chức năng tùy chỉnh trong Python để tính tỷ lệ phần trăm.%s operator enables you to add value to a Python string. The %s signifies that you want to add a string value to the string; it is also used to format numbers in a string. That’s it.

Bạn có thể muốn thêm một câu lệnh IF toàn bộ là 0 trở lại 0 vì nếu không, điều này sẽ ném một ngoại lệ.

Nếu bạn muốn tỷ lệ phần trăm của nhau, bạn cần sử dụng mã sau.

Python % Dấu hiệu (toán tử modulo)

Dấu phần trăm trong Python được gọi là toán tử modulo,%, & & nbsp; trả về phần còn lại sau khi chia toán hạng bên trái cho toán hạng bên phải.

Đầu ra sẽ xuất hiện dưới dạng 1 1. Tại đây, toán tử modulo,%người%trả về phần còn lại sau khi chia hai số.

Tôi đã bắt đầu và ngừng học Python một số lần đáng xấu hổ. & nbsp; đoán xem? & nbsp; Tôi lại ở đó. & nbsp; vì lý do tôi không thể giải thích đầy đủ, tôi chưa bao giờ thực sự có thể bám vào nó. & nbsp; Rốt cuộc, tôi là một anh chàng kết nối mạng. & nbsp; Tôi luôn muốn viết mã của riêng mình nhưng trong một số hình thức của nhà văn, tôi không bao giờ có thể đưa ra một lý do tại sao để lập trình. & nbsp; Như tôi đã biết, tôi chưa bao giờ thực hiện tất cả những bước nhảy vọt quan trọng vào vương quốc, ở đây, cách thức tôi có thể sử dụng điều này để làm cho cuộc sống của tôi tốt hơn | mát mẻ hơn | dễ dàng hơn. & nbsp; đáng suy ngẫm, tôi biết. & nbsp; bây giờ tôi thấy mình tràn ngập các ý tưởng cho các chương trình tôi muốn viết. & nbsp; Tôi đã tràn ngập họ. & nbsp; có thể nói với bạn những gì họ là, hãy nhớ bạn. & nbsp; Tôi, giống như hầu hết, đang chờ đợi mọi người biết tôi bằng tên cuối cùng của tôi (Zuck, ya, thấy).

Là một hình thức đền tội, tôi luôn bắt đầu trở lại khi bắt đầu Python. & nbsp; Tôi buộc bản thân phải đọc (mặc dù nhanh chóng) chương về Python là gì và tại sao nó lại tốt và sau đó tôi đọc phần về cách cài đặt Python (Windows). & nbsp; Khi tôi gõ cái này (trên iMac của tôi), tôi đang chạy một chiếc Ubuntu VM và cửa sổ 8 VM (Chúa, tôi ghét Windows 8). & nbsp; Python là Python là Python, tất nhiên. & nbsp; Tôi chỉ muốn xem liệu có gì khác ở bất cứ đâu không (điều mà tôi không mong đợi). & nbsp; Thật tốt khi trải qua các chuyển động, ngay cả với hệ điều hành, tôi không sử dụng nhiều hơn nữa (cửa sổ) và đảm bảo tôi trung thực về tất cả chúng.

Tôi sở hữu Internet cũng như một vài cuốn sách về lập trình Python vì vậy tôi nghĩ rằng tôi đã trang bị khá tốt với tài liệu học tập. & nbsp; Tôi cũng có đăng ký của mình cho khóa học kịch bản Python Vivek Ramachadran. & nbsp; quá thêm vào đó tôi đã bỏ 30 đô la trên Zed Shaw, học Python theo cách khó khăn. & nbsp; Nó miễn phí ở định dạng HTML nhưng bạn có thể mua các video và PDF, để đơn giản hóa cuộc sống của bạn và có được một số tính năng bổ sung đáng giá. & nbsp; Điều đó và ông Shaw nói rằng ông sẽ cung cấp hỗ trợ email. & nbsp; một mình sẽ trị giá $ 30. & nbsp;

print 3 + 2 + 1 - 5 + 4 % 2 - 1 / 4 + 6

Câu trả lời cho phương trình đó là 7. & nbsp; sau khi phá vỡ một số pemdas, tôi thấy mình chú ý nhìn chằm chằm vào phần trăm%ngồi ở giữa phương trình. & nbsp; và tôi không thể hiểu được ý nghĩa của nó. & nbsp; phần buồn là tôi nhớ không biết đó là lần cuối cùng tôi học Python nhưng tôi không thể nhớ được việc học nó. & nbsp; thế nào là khập khiễng? & nbsp; Tôi nhớ không biết nhưng tôi không nhớ kết quả của việc sửa lỗi không biết. & nbsp; tâm trí tôi càng lớn tuổi tôi càng thích cách nó hoạt động.

Tôi đã thử một vài vấn đề toán học để xem liệu tôi có thể suy ra ý nghĩa của nó không.

print "What is 5 + 4 % 5?:"
print: "Answer: ", 5 + 4 % 5

Câu trả lời: & nbsp; 9.

Tào lao. & nbsp; điều đó đã giúp đỡ. & nbsp; Lời khuyên sau đây #5 từ giới thiệu ZED (tức là hãy cố gắng tự mình tìm ra) Tôi đã từ chối Google nó. & nbsp; Tôi đã tiếp tục thử các phương trình khác nhau nhưng không có phương trình nào khiến cho%người dùng tiết lộ một cách kỳ diệu mục đích của nó.

60.0
0

Câu trả lời cho câu hỏi đó là 5. & nbsp; vâng, tôi đã bị lạc. & nbsp; Tôi thường ổn khi nhìn thấy các mẫu theo số nhưng như tôi đã lưu ý trước đó, tôi đã già đi. & nbsp; vì vậy tôi đã mủi lòng. & nbsp; tôi googled. & nbsp; đây là những gì tôi đã học được:

Sử dụng #1

Trong Python, phần trăm%có hai lần sử dụng khác nhau. & nbsp; Đầu tiên, khi được sử dụng trong một bài toán như ở trên, nó được sử dụng để đại diện cho mô đun. & nbsp; mô đun của một số là phần còn lại còn lại khi bạn chia. & nbsp; 4 mod 5 = 4 (bạn có thể chia 5 thành 4 lần với phần còn lại là 4). & nbsp; Tương tự, 5 mod 4 = 1 (bạn có thể chia 4 thành 5 một lần với phần còn lại là 1. & nbsp; Tôi thậm chí đã thực hiện bộ phận dài để chứng minh điều đó. & nbsp; kiểm tra nó.

Hướng dẫn what is percentage in python - phần trăm trong python là bao nhiêu

Sử dụng #2

Trong một chuỗi văn bản, phần trăm%khác tìm thấy một cách sử dụng hoàn toàn khác. Trong một chuỗi, nó có thể được sử dụng để định dạng. & nbsp; các ký tự thường được đặt trong các trích dẫn (Hồi giáo) được đối xử theo nghĩa đen, không phải là bất kỳ loại mã nào. & nbsp; Điều này có nghĩa là khi bạn nhập vào 5 + 4, Python sẽ xem nó dưới dạng chuỗi văn bản 5 + 4 (tức là không phải là toán học). & nbsp; Python sẽ không coi đó là một vấn đề toán học tương đương với 9. & nbsp; nếu bạn nhập 5 + 4 vào Python mà không có dấu ngoặc đơn, thì đó là toán học. & nbsp; Python sẽ khủng hoảng các con số và nói với bạn rằng đó là 9. Để cực kỳ rõ ràng, trong Python:
To be exceedingly clear, in python:

  • “5 + 4” là văn bản 5 + 4
  • 5 + 4 là 9

Khi bạn sử dụng % bên trong một chuỗi, nó nói với Python rằng có một cái gì đó đang diễn ra bên trong chuỗi không được cho là theo nghĩa đen; Có một cái gì đó cho Python để làm. & nbsp; hãy để khám phá:

Xem xét chuỗi này:

60.0
1

Khi chạy trong Python, nó sẽ chỉ cần in chuỗi văn bản chính xác. & nbsp; không có gì đặc biệt thú vị về điều đó.

Tôi có thể hoàn thành một kỳ tích tương tự bằng cách sử dụng các biến. & nbsp; ví dụ:

60.0
2

60.0
3

Nó hoạt động nhưng nó rất bận rộn. & nbsp; Lưu ý cách tôi phải rút các biến ra khỏi chuỗi để lấy Python biến chúng thành số. & nbsp; mã sau sẽ không tạo ra kết quả mong muốn:

60.0
4

Cũng không:

60.0
5

Dưới đây là cả ba và đầu ra tương ứng của chúng:

60.0
6

60.0
7

Hai dòng cuối cùng thất bại.

Nhưng hãy xem những gì mà%"trong một chuỗi văn bản có thể làm được:

60.0
8

60.0
3

Mặc dù vậy, bạn thực sự phải tạo ra các biến để sử dụng điều này. Bạn có thể làm được việc này:

def percentage(part, whole):
  percentage = 100 * float(part)/float(whole)
  return str(percentage) + "%"

print(percentage(3, 5))
0

Và vâng, bạn thậm chí có thể sử dụng nhiều biến thay thế. & nbsp; ví dụ:

def percentage(part, whole):
  percentage = 100 * float(part)/float(whole)
  return str(percentage) + "%"

print(percentage(3, 5))
1

60.0
3

Và cuối cùng, điều này cũng sẽ hoạt động:

def percentage(part, whole):
  percentage = 100 * float(part)/float(whole)
  return str(percentage) + "%"

print(percentage(3, 5))
3

Thực tế, có một loạt các tùy chọn khác cho toàn bộ điều định dạng Chuỗi của%. & nbsp; văn bản thay thế chỉ là phần nổi của những gì nó có thể làm. & nbsp; cho phép tôi hướng bạn đến một bài viết ngắn gọn và vui nhộn cung cấp thêm sự xây dựng về việc sử dụng định dạng chuỗi. & nbsp; bạn cũng có thể thấy thông tin kỹ thuật quyết định (và không hữu ích cho người mới) trong tài liệu Python nằm trên trang web Python.org.

Cheers,

Colin Weaver

Phần trăm có nghĩa là gì trong Python?

Biểu tượng % trong Python được gọi là toán tử modulo.Nó trả về phần còn lại của việc chia toán hạng tay trái cho toán hạng bên phải.Nó được sử dụng để có được phần còn lại của một vấn đề phân chia.returns the remainder of dividing the left hand operand by right hand operand. It's used to get the remainder of a division problem.

%S có nghĩa là gì trong Python?

Biểu tượng % được sử dụng trong Python với nhiều loại dữ liệu và cấu hình.%s đặc biệt được sử dụng để thực hiện kết nối các chuỗi với nhau.Nó cho phép chúng ta định dạng một giá trị bên trong một chuỗi.Nó được sử dụng để kết hợp một chuỗi khác trong một chuỗi.used to perform concatenation of strings together. It allows us to format a value inside a string. It is used to incorporate another string within a string.

Làm thế nào để bạn viết tỷ lệ phần trăm trong Python?

Để in một giá trị phần trăm trong Python, hãy sử dụng str.Định dạng () phương thức hoặc chuỗi f trên mẫu ngôn ngữ định dạng "{: ...
your_number = 0,42 ..
Tỷ lệ phần trăm = "{:. 0%}".Định dạng (your_number).
print(percentage).

Tỷ lệ phần trăm trong mã là gì?

Dấu phần trăm được sử dụng phổ biến nhất để chỉ ra văn bản không thể sử dụng được trong phần thân của chương trình.Văn bản này thường được sử dụng để bao gồm các bình luận trong mã của bạn.Một số chức năng cũng diễn giải phần trăm dấu là một nhà xác định chuyển đổi.most commonly used to indicate nonexecutable text within the body of a program. This text is normally used to include comments in your code. Some functions also interpret the percent sign as a conversion specifier.